Kelly Clarkson Proves She’s Miss Independent, Indeed!

by staff on June 14, 2007

With just two weeks to go before the release of her much-anticipated (and recently leaked) third album, My December, Kelly Clarkson fired her management team Monday night (June 11). Reportedly, internal bickering between SonyBMG and Kelly Clarkson over hersongwriting and direction of My December led to the split.

The ex-management team issued a statement on June 12 saying, ”Kelly Clarkson is an enormously talented artist. We are pleased to have served as her managers during her well-deserved rise to stardom and are proud of the role we played in backing her creative choices. We believed in Kelly from the day we met her and believe in her now. We have only the best wishes and hopes for her in the future.”

The bickering has already affected radio play of ”Never Again.” It was getting great response on radio stations, but has kind of stalled on the charts lately. Experts are also predicting that her cd will flop and flop big.
Earlier this year, Kelly said, ”I know it’s not going to do what Breakaway did, ’cause it’s not as mainstream. I get that. Some of the songs are not what 10-year-olds are probably going to listen to.”
Most agree that the fighting between Clive Davis (head of her label) and her management team will hurt sales. When the people who are supposed to stand behind you are doing so with knives in their hands - things get ugly fast!

Ace Young and Aaron Carter Share the Love

by staff on June 11, 2007

Ace Young and Aaron Carter joined hundreds of patients and their families at the 16th annual “Celebrate Life with Hope,” part of National Cancer Survivors’ Day on June 10, 2007 (Sunday).

The celebration is the largest event for pediatric cancer survivors in the Western United States and provides patients, caregivers and former patients from the Childrens Center for Cancer and Blood Diseases at Childrens Hospital Los Angeles a chance to reunite with each other.
